Chapter 90 Edward

  • “Edward…Oh Prince Edward,” a mystical voice cooed. “Oh Edward, you better open your eyes before I lose my patience. Oh Edward. Prince Edward.” There was silent and no movement coming from the man lying on the smoky floor. “Open your eyes!” the voice commanded now and Edward’s eyes snapped open and he let out a heavy gasp. He laid still, not understanding what was happening until he took a look of his surroundings. He jumped to his feet immediately, feeling lighthearted and rubbed his temple, closing his eyes and shaking off the dizziness.
  • He opened his eyes once more and glanced around, there was smoke everywhere, no single building in sight and he glanced at his feet. It looked like he was standing on the clouds but he could feel the hardened ground and he furrowed his brows. He looked up once more, there was no clear sky, only clouds of smoke. He moved forward but after moving for what felt like hours it seemed like he hadn’t moved an inch and was back at where he began. Edward shook his head and took his right this time but like earlier, it felt like he was just going around in circles. It’s a little misty and obviously cloudy or rather smoky. He couldn’t see anyone or any object in fact. It was like he was alone in the universe but he was very sure that he heard a voice calling for him just now.
  • He tried to remember how he got there but his memory seemed jagged and he couldn’t quite place it. He thought harder and only stopped when he was having a headache. He grabbed his head, groaning in pain as he tried to numb the pain. After some minutes, he could stand straight again and he decided to figure out his surrounding once more.
